Kalypso is an open source application for geospatial modelling and simulation. It is primarily developed to be a user friendly tool for GIS-based modelling and simulation of hydrological and hydraulic numerical models.

Features

  • Hydrological model
  • Water surface profile model
  • Unsteady coupled 1D/2D finite element model
  • Module for flood depth determination
  • Module for flood risk determination
